PageMan Posted April 10, 2004 Report Share Posted April 10, 2004 (edited) Hickman Co.....1..3..1....0..0..0....0.....5...6...5 Lewis Co.........2..0..2....4..0..0....x.....8..10..4 WP - Nathaniel Sublett, Save - Tim Watson LP - Josh Brown HR - None Triples - HC: Jo Jo Walsh Doubles - LC: Clay Colley Hickman Co. scored 1 run in the 1st inn. as Richard Deal singled to LF and scored on a triple by Jo Jo Walsh. Lewis Co. scored 2 in the bottom of the 1st. as Dustin McConnell had an infield single, stole 2nd, and scored on a double to RC by Clay Colley. Tim Watson then reached base on an infield error and stole 2nd - during this play, Colley stole home on the throw to 2nd in a very close play at the plate on the return throw. HC added 3 in the 2nd as Jordan Hedges walked & made 2nd on a dropped ball on a force when C. J. Pillow hit the ball to SS. Both runners advanced on a throwing error in an attempted pick off and scored on a single by Patrick Brady. Brady scored on an infield error that should have been the 3rd out. HC added their final run in the 3rd when Hedges was hit by a pitch, stole 2nd, advanced to 3rd on a single by Pillow, and scored on a single by Cody Seymore. Lewis added 2 in the 3rd as Drew Wills singled to RF, Watson walked, and both score on a dropped fly ball to the outfield by Garrett Ammons. Lewis scored 4 in the 4th as Kyle Roberson reached base on a missed pop up, advanced to 3rd on a single by Nathaniel Sublett to RF. Sublett took 2nd on defensive indifference and both scored on a single by McConnell. HC then turned a double play - U4, 4-3. With 2 outs now, Colley was hit by a pitch & advanced to 3rd on a single by Watson. Watson was almost caught in a run down, but an errorant throw allowed him to reach 2nd and Colley scored on the error. Watson scored on a single by Zach Wright. Pitching: Blake Sullivan was the starter for Lewis Co. and went 3 inn., gave up 5 runs - 3 earned - on 5 hits, 5 K's, 1 walk, & 1 HB. Nathaniel Sublett came on in the 4, pitched 3 inn., 0 runs, 1 hit, 5 K's, & 2 walks. Tim Watson pitched the final inn. with 0 runs, no hits, 2 K's, no walks, & 1 HB. Josh Brown was the starter for Hickman Co. went 3 inn. plus 3 batters in the 4th, gave up 6 runs - 3 earned - on 6 hits, 4 K's, 1 walk, & 1 HB. Ben House came on in the 4th, pitched 2 inn., gave up 2 runs - 0 earned, I think - on 4 hits, 3 K's, 1 walk, & 1 HB. Nathan Winslett finished the game with 1 inn. pitched, 0 runs, 0 hits, 0 K's, 0 walks, & 1 HB. This report is subject to change once I do a detailed report later tonight.
